libu2f-host0-1.1.9-28.1.i586.rpm


Advertisement

Description

libu2f-host0 - Library for Universal 2nd Factor (U2F)

Property Value
Distribution openSUSE Tumbleweed
Repository Security all
Package filename libu2f-host0-1.1.9-28.1.i586.rpm
Package name libu2f-host0
Package version 1.1.9
Package release 28.1
Package architecture i586
Package type rpm
Category Productivity/Networking/Security
Homepage https://developers.yubico.com/
License LGPL-2.1-or-later
Maintainer -
Download size 22.68 KB
Installed size 33.64 KB
Libu2f-host provide a C library that implements
the host-side of the U2F protocol.  There are APIs to talk to a U2F
device and perform the U2F Register and U2F Authenticate operations.

Alternatives

Package Version Architecture Repository
libu2f-host0-1.1.9-28.1.x86_64.rpm 1.1.9 x86_64 Security
libu2f-host0-1.1.9-1.1.x86_64.rpm 1.1.9 x86_64 openSUSE Oss
libu2f-host0-1.1.9-1.1.i586.rpm 1.1.9 i586 openSUSE Oss
libu2f-host0 - - -

Requires

Name Value
/sbin/ldconfig -
libc.so.6(GLIBC_2.4) -
libcrypto.so.1.1 -
libcrypto.so.1.1(OPENSSL_1_1_0) -
libhidapi-hidraw.so.0 -
libjson-c.so.4 -

Provides

Name Value
libu2f-host.so.0 -
libu2f-host.so.0(U2F_HOST_0.0) -
libu2f-host.so.0(U2F_HOST_1.1) -
libu2f-host0 = 1.1.9-28.1
libu2f-host0(x86-32) = 1.1.9-28.1

Download

Type URL
Mirror widehat.opensuse.org
Binary Package libu2f-host0-1.1.9-28.1.i586.rpm
Source Package libu2f-host-1.1.9-28.1.src.rpm

Install Howto

  1. Add the Security repository:
    # zypper addrepo http://widehat.opensuse.org/opensuse/repositories/security/openSUSE_Tumbleweed/ security
  2. Install libu2f-host0 rpm package:
    # zypper install libu2f-host0

Files

Path
/usr/lib/libu2f-host.so.0
/usr/lib/libu2f-host.so.0.1.9

Changelog

2019-03-06 - Karol Babioch <kbabioch@suse.de>
- Version 1.1.9 (released 2019-03-06)
- Fix CID copying from the init response, which broke compatibility with some
devices.
2019-03-05 - Karol Babioch <kbabioch@suse.de>
- Version 1.1.8 (released 2019-03-05)
- Add udev rules
- Drop 70-old-u2f.rules and use 70-u2f.rules for everything
- Use a random nonce for setting up CID to prevent fingerprinting
- CVE-2019-9578: Parse the response to init in a more stable way to prevent
leakage of uninitialized stack memory back to the device (bnc#1128140).
2019-02-08 - Karol Babioch <kbabioch@suse.de>
- Version 1.1.7 (released 2019-01-08)
- Fix for trusting length from deivce in device init.
- Fix for buffer overflow when receiving data from device. (YSA-2019-01,
CVE-2018-20340, bsc#1124781)
- Add udev rules for some new devices.
- Using %license macro
- Applied spec-cleaner
2018-05-15 - kbabioch@suse.com
- Version 1.1.6 (released 2018-05-15)
- Change waiting logic on authenticate to allow for faster feedback.
- Version 1.1.5 (released 2018-03-07)
- Fix refcount when adding json_objects.
- Handle fido2 keepalive.
- Add udev rules for more devices.
2017-09-13 - kkaempf@suse.com
- Version 1.1.4 (released 2017-09-01)
- Added more u2f devices to the udev rulesets.
- Increase buffer size, allowing for bigger certificates.
- Add u2f.conf.sample for FreeBSD permission handling.
2016-10-12 - t.gruner@katodev.de
- Version 1.1.3 (released 2016-10-04)
- Added more u2f devices to the udev rulesets.
- Fixup mac builds.
- Version 1.1.2 (released 2016-06-22)
- Make authenticate return U2FH_OK if touch is set to not needed. Also minor fixes to error output of authenticate.
- Documentation fixes.
- Compilation fixes on visual studio.
- Add udev rules for Feitian devices.
- Add optional cmake build.
- Change license of the commandline tool to LGPL 2.1+
- remove udev.patch
2016-05-19 - t.gruner@katodev.de
- Add buildrequirement for libudev to select the rule for udev.
- Add udev directories in %files
- Add udev rule for Feitian ePass FIDO (udev.patch)
- Change License for the library
2016-03-23 - jengelh@inai.de
- Avoid undesired blank lines at start of descriptions.
Expand description. Trim filelist.
2016-03-21 - t.gruner@katodev.de
- Version 1.1.1 (released 2016-03-14)
- Use correct index in u2fh_devs_discover()
- Fix an issue where we left the authenticate loop early.
- Fix an issue where authenticate remembered which devices to skip.
- Stop validating the scheme of the origin.
- Fixup a crash in u2fh_devs_discover() with closing unplugged devices.
- Documentation fixes.
2016-02-18 - t.gruner@katodev.de
- Version 1.1.0 (released 2016-02-15)
- Add udev rules for more devices.
- Don?t return success when no data is received.
- Fix typos.
- Make send_apdu send data like chrome does.
- Don?t release json object that we don?t own no more.
- Don?t do memcmp on uninitialized memory.
- Add u2fh_authenticate2() and u2fh_register2().
- Remove base64 padding (required by spec).
- Use unsigned ints to prevent buffer overflows.

See Also

Package Description
libu2f-server-devel-1.1.0-9.6.i586.rpm Development files for Universal 2nd Factor (U2F)
libu2f-server-devel-1.1.0-9.6.x86_64.rpm Development files for Universal 2nd Factor (U2F)
libu2f-server0-1.1.0-9.6.i586.rpm Library for Universal 2nd Factor (U2F)
libu2f-server0-1.1.0-9.6.x86_64.rpm Library for Universal 2nd Factor (U2F)
libusbauth-configparser-devel-1.0.1-12.1.i586.rpm Development part of library for USB Firewall including flex/bison parser
libusbauth-configparser-devel-1.0.1-12.1.x86_64.rpm Development part of library for USB Firewall including flex/bison parser
libusbauth-configparser1-1.0.1-12.1.i586.rpm Library for USB Firewall including flex/bison parser
libusbauth-configparser1-1.0.1-12.1.x86_64.rpm Library for USB Firewall including flex/bison parser
libykclient-devel-2.15-9.35.i586.rpm Online validation of Yubikey OTPs
libykclient-devel-2.15-9.35.x86_64.rpm Online validation of Yubikey OTPs
libykclient3-2.15-9.35.i586.rpm Online validation of Yubikey OTPs
libykclient3-2.15-9.35.x86_64.rpm Online validation of Yubikey OTPs
libykcs11-1-1.6.2-26.6.i586.rpm Yubikey NEO PKCS#11 applet library
libykcs11-1-1.6.2-26.6.x86_64.rpm Yubikey NEO PKCS#11 applet library
libykcs11-devel-1.6.2-26.6.i586.rpm Development files for the Yubikey NEO PKCS#11 applet library
Advertisement
Advertisement